Összefoglaló szövege

Introduction. Myocarditis is a polyetiological inflammatory heart disease with a wide range of clinical manifestations, from asymptomatic to life-threatening conditions such as heart failure and sudden cardiac death.

Aims. The aim of this work was to investigate the immune response and molecular changes in the myocardium of male BALB/c mice at 14, 28, 42 and 60 days after immunization.

Methods. Myocarditis was modeled in adult male (n=20) BALB/c mice, which got subcutaneous injection of 150 μg of α-myosin (Med Chem Express) with 120 μL of complete and incomplete Freund's adjuvant (Sigma) on days 0 and 7. Control group with Freund's Adjuvant injection (n=10) was injected with 120 μL of complete and incomplete Freund's adjuvant (Sigma) on days 0 and 7. Control group animals males (n=10) were not injected. Animals were sacrificed 14, 28, 42 and 60 days after the second immunization by decapitation. The level of Hif1α, Nfκb, Tgfβ, Il1, Il6, Il10 expression in the myocardium was assessed by RT-PCR. The number of immune cells and fibroblasts in the myocardium was determined on histological slides stained with H&E. The data were processed in «Statistica» (Kruskall-Wallis test, Dunn’s multiply comparisons test).

Result. The number of immune cells and fibroblasts in the myocardium was higher in the experimental groups than in the control groups, which can indicate the development of myocarditis. There was no difference in gene expression between the control group and the group with the injection of Freund's adjutant. Compared to the control group, on 14 days the expression of Nfκb and Il1 increases and then decreases sharply. Il10 and Il6 expression increases at 42 and 60 days. Expression of Hif1α and Tgfβ increases on days 14 and 42.

Conclusion. Changes in the dynamics of gene expression have been revealed. Markers of acute inflammation were higher at 14 days, while markers of chronic inflammation and anti-inflammation activity were higher at late stages. The first increase of Hif1α is associated with the inflammation, and at 42 days it is associated with the adaptation response. The increase of Tgfβ may be associated with fibrosis. According to the data can be observed in the development of myocarditis, should be investigated physiological changes during myocarditis.
